首先,我們要把硬件連接好,把板子插到我們的電腦上,打開設(shè)備管理器查看所使用的是哪個(gè) COM 口,如圖 2-21 所示,找到“USB-SERIAL CH340(COM5)”這一項(xiàng),這里最后的數(shù)字就是開發(fā)板目前所使用的 COM 端口號(hào)。
圖 2-21 查看COM口
然后 STC 系列單片的下載軟件——STC-ISP,如圖 2-22 所示。
圖2-22 程序下載設(shè)置
下載軟件列出了 5 個(gè)步驟:第一步,選擇單片機(jī)型號(hào),我們現(xiàn)在用的單片機(jī)型號(hào)是STC89C52RC,這個(gè)一定不能選錯(cuò)了;第二步,點(diǎn)擊“打開程序文件”,找到我們剛才建立工程的那個(gè) lesson2 文件夾,找到 LED.hex 這個(gè)文件,點(diǎn)擊打開;第三步,選擇剛才查到的 COM口,波特率使用默認(rèn)的就行;第四步,這里的所有選項(xiàng)都使用默認(rèn)設(shè)置,不要隨便更改,有的選項(xiàng)改錯(cuò)了以后可能會(huì)產(chǎn)生麻煩。第五步,因?yàn)?STC 單片機(jī)要冷啟動(dòng)下載,就是先點(diǎn)下載,然后再給單片機(jī)上電,所以我們先關(guān)閉板子上的電源開關(guān),然后點(diǎn)擊“Download/下載”按鈕,等待軟件提示你請上電后,如圖 2-23 所示,然后再按下板子的電源開關(guān),就可以將程序下載到單片機(jī)里邊了。當(dāng)軟件顯示“已加密”就表示程序下載成功了,如圖 2-24 所示。
圖 2-23 程序下載過程
圖 2-24 程序下載完畢
程序下載完畢后,就會(huì)自動(dòng)運(yùn)行,大家可以在板子上看到那一排 LED 中最右側(cè)的小燈已經(jīng)發(fā)光了。那現(xiàn)在如果我們把 LED = 0 改成 LED = 1,再重新編譯程序下載進(jìn)去新的 HEX 文件,燈就會(huì)熄滅。至此,點(diǎn)亮一個(gè) LED 的實(shí)驗(yàn)已經(jīng)完成,終于邁出了第一步,是不是還挺好玩的呢。